What is the population of Woodford?
According to the 2021 census, Woodford had a population of 4,022 people. The town has been growing steadily over recent census periods
What local amenities are available in Woodford?
Woodford offers a public library on Elizabeth Street and a Woolworths supermarket that opened in 2010. The Woodford Markets are held on the third Sunday of each month in the town centre
What transport history does Woodford have?
Woodford was once a stop on the Kilcoy railway line, with a station serving the town until the early 1960s. After the line closed, most of the railway infrastructure was removed
What cultural attractions can I visit near the property?
The Australian Narrow Gauge Railway Museum operates at the former Woodford railway station, running heritage steam trains on the first and third Sundays of each month. The Woodford Historical Society Museum at 109 Archer Street also showcases local history
